Accident Lockheed P-80A Shooting Star 44-85373, Saturday 21 August 1948

Date:Saturday 21 August 1948
Time:
Type:Silhouette image of generic f80 model; specific model in this crash may look slightly different    
Lockheed P-80A Shooting Star
Owner/operator:United States Air Force - USAF
Registration: 44-85373
MSN: 080-1396
Fatalities:Fatalities: 1 / Occupants: 1
Other fatalities:0
Aircraft damage: Destroyed
Location:6M NNE Misawa AFB -   Japan
Phase: En route
Nature:Military
Departure airport:Misawa AFB
Destination airport:
Narrative:
Crashed after an engine failure, Written off in Japan.
